Shimla, Feb. 11 -- Himachal Pradesh public works minister Vikramaditya Singh said on Monday that the cabinet will take a call on whether to implement the Unified Pension Scheme (UPS) or not.
"Whether to implement UPS or not will be discussed in the cabinet meeting. The profit and loss of the employees will be taken into consideration. Whatever reduces the financial burden on the state will be considered," he said.
The statement comes after the state received a letter from the Centre, asking for implementation of UPS and assuring financial assistance of Rs.1,600 crore.
